When performing clock calculations, the ppc405_uc code
has several places where it multiplies together two
32-bit variables and assigns the result to a 64-bit
variable. This doesn't quite do what is intended because
C will compute a 32-bit multiply result. Add casts to
ensure we don't truncate the result.
(Spotted by Coverity, CID 1005504, 1005505.)
